Восстановление данных с RAID 5 на 6 дисках - пропал доступ к данным.

Оборудование:

  • Контроллер Hewlett-Packard HP 6 Port SATA PCI-X RAID Controller
  • Диски WD10EZEX-08WN4A0

Проблема:

  • После скачка напряжения пропал доступ к данным, рейд предположительно 5, 2 диска не определяются

Инструменты:

  • Паяльная станция
  • Плата контроллера жесткого диска-донора
  • РС3000
  • RAID Reconstructor
  • R-Studio
  • Victoria HDD
Диагностика и восстановление

Принесли 6 дисков с описанием, что на них был собран, вроде как, RAID 5, но не точно, и после того как вырубили свет в здании массив перестал быть доступен и в биосе контроллера два диска перестали определяться. Первым делом мы стали проверять диски какие диски определяются и на сколько они работоспособны. На ПАК РС3000 мы определили какие 4 диска определяются, создали копию модулей служебной информации и в программе Victoria HDD запустили сканирование поверхности для поиска ББ (бэд блоков), если таковые имеются.

У двух дисков, которые перестали определяться, диагностировались две разные проблемы: у одного проблемы со служебной программой, у другого – сгорел контроллер. И какой из дисков когда вывалился из рейд массива неизвестно, так что пришлось реанимировать оба диска и делать их копию на наши исправные диски.

А пока шел процесс снятия образа мы решили определить параметры массива: порядок дисков и размер блока данных. Мы уже набили руку делать это с помощью программы RAID Reconstructor через тест энтропии. В данном случе он выглядит так и на нем видно, что на момент построения энтропии не хватает двух дисков, что соответствует действительности.

По этой картинке легко определяются: размер блока данных, который равен 128 секторов или 64 кб, порядок дисков и что в этом порядке не хватает 2 и 4 диска. После того, как получим копии неисправных дисков, можно будет приступить к сборке массива. Мы же имеем дело с рейд 5 и допустима «потеря» одного диска, чтобы можно было без потерь восстановить данные.

Когда все участники RAID массива стали доступны для сборки, рейд решили собрать в R-Studio. Это было обусловлено тремя основными причинами:

  1. Файловая система на рейд массиве NTFS
  2. Возможность сортировки файлов по дате изменения
  3. Удобство интерфейса в исключении диска из сборки, путем снятия галочки.
RAID контроллер

Выставив диски в правильном порядке в R-Studio, указав размер блока, путем перебора определили порядок распределения контрольных сумм. Когда стала открываться партиция, чтобы не искать «свежие» данные в ручную, мы отсортировали файлы в дате изменения и проверили открываются ли недавно измененные файлы или нет. По такому признаку можно понять есть ли в сборке неактуальный диск. И проверять надо на файлах в несколько мегабайт.

В нашем случае последние добавленные фото не открывались. На вкладке сбора массива путем исключения дисков из сборки мы добились, что фото стали открываться. Это оказалась финальная сборка, после определения которой, мы приступили к сохранению данных на отдельный диск.

Случаи потери данных на RAID 5 не редкость, поэтому советуем даже при использовании рейд5 для хранения данных позаботься о резервном копирования наиболее важных данных. Если у вас пропали данные на рейд массиве любого уровня, не предпринимайте необдуманных действий: не запускайте ребилд, инициализацию массива, проверки файловой системы и пр. Это может сделать невозможным восстановление данные в принципе.

Мы, специалисты компании HDDprofi, опыт каждого уже более 20 лет, успешно восстанавливаем данные с RAID различных конфигураций. Обращайтесь и мы поможем!

Диагностика бесплатная! Оплата за положительный результат!

Позвоните нашим специалистам для бесплатной консультации по телефону 8(800)350-94-46
Или заполните форму обратной связи